Ouverture des requêtes Access via ODBC. SAP Enterprise 4.1 Support Package 1
Connexion aux sources de données et requêtes
Cette section décrit plusieurs procédures habituelles relatives à l'accès aux fichiers de base de données
à partir de Crystal Reports. Lorsque c'est utile, des instructions pas à pas sont fournies.
6.5.1 Ouverture des requêtes Access via ODBC
ODBC vous permet d'exercer un meilleur contrôle sur les parties de la base de données que vous voulez utiliser. C'est pourquoi l'emploi d'une requête Access via ODBC requiert quelques étapes supplémentaires.
6.5.1.1 Pour ouvrir des requêtes Access via ODBC
1.
Vous pouvez ouvrir une requête Access lors de la création d'un rapport ou plus tard.
• Pour ouvrir une requête Access lors de la création d'un rapport, cliquez sur Fichier > Nouveau
> Depuis la source de données.
• Pour ouvrir une requête Access dans un rapport existant, cliquez sur Données > Modifier les
sources de données.
La boîte de dialogue "Choisir une connexion à une source de données" s'affiche.
2.
Sélectionnez Connexion par fournisseur.
3.
Cliquez sur Microsoft > MS Access année > ODBC, puis sur Suivant.
La boîte de dialogue "Configurer votre connexion" s'affiche.
4.
Définissez le "Nom de la source de données" et vos paramètres de connexion.
Vous pouvez vérifier la connexion en cliquant sur Tester la connexion.
Si cela est nécessaire, renseignez les détails dans les onglets "Paramètres de configuration" et
"Paramètres personnalisés".
5.
Recherchez votre requête dans le dossier Vues et faites-la glisser vers la liste "Tables sélectionnées".
6.
Cliquez sur Terminer.
Remarque :
Vous ne pouvez pas utiliser les requêtes d'action ou de mise à jour Access dans Crystal Reports.
Toutefois, vous pouvez utiliser les requêtes de sélection et de tableaux croisés Access.
6.5.1.2 Ouverture des requêtes de paramètre Access
154 2013-09-19
Connexion aux sources de données et requêtes
Les requêtes de paramètre Access ne peuvent être ouvertes que si une base de données Access a
été ouverte via ODBC. Il convient donc de vérifier que vous disposez d'une source de données ODBC pour votre base de données Access avant de déclencher la procédure. Voir
Configurer une source de données ODBC .
Remarque :
Lorsque vous créez une requête de paramètre dans Access, vous devez fournir une invite pour la requête et spécifier le type de données pour le paramètre. Vous commencez avec la requête ouverte en mode Conception dans Microsoft Access, saisissez dans la cellule Critères l'invite du champ qui servira de paramètre. Choisissez ensuite la commande Paramètres depuis le menu Requête dans
Access et spécifiez un type de données pour le paramètre que vous venez de créer. Vérifiez que l'invite apparaît exactement telle que celle qui se trouve dans la cellule Critères. Pour des instructions complètes, voir la documentation Access. Si vous n'installez pas correctement la requête de paramètre,
Crystal Reports ne pourra pas s'en servir.
6.5.1.2.1 Pour ouvrir une requête de paramètre Access
1.
Sur la Page de début, cliquez sur Depuis la source de données.
2.
Recherchez et sélectionnez la source de données ODBC qui contient la requête de paramètre
Access que vous souhaitez utiliser.
Remarque :
Si votre base de données requiert un nom d'utilisateur et un mot de passe, ou toute autre information de connexion, cliquez sur Suivant pour atteindre la boîte de dialogue Références de connexion.
Conseil :
Le choix d'une source de données ODBC et la saisie d'informations de connexion vous connectent automatiquement au serveur.
3.
Recherchez votre requête Paramètre dans le dossier Procédures stockées et faites-la glisser vers la liste Tables sélectionnées.
4.
Cliquez sur Terminer.
5.
Créez votre rapport en utilisant les champs de la Requête de paramètre.
6.
Cliquez sur Actualiser pour mettre à jour les données du rapport.
La boîte de dialogue Saisissez les valeurs d'invite s'affiche à l'écran.
7.
Saisissez une valeur dans le champ, puis cliquez sur OK.
Votre rapport s'affiche. Seuls les enregistrements répondant aux valeurs de paramètre que vous avez spécifiées dans la boîte de dialogue Saisir des valeurs de paramètre seront utilisés dans votre rapport.
Remarque :
Vous ne pouvez pas utiliser les requêtes d'action ou de mise à jour Access dans Crystal Reports.
Toutefois, vous pouvez utiliser les requêtes de sélection et de tableaux croisés Access.
155 2013-09-19

Публичная ссылка обновлена
Публичная ссылка на ваш чат обновлена.